语音视频SDK对设备性能有要求吗?
语音视频SDK,即语音视频软件开发工具包,是一种为开发者提供语音和视频通信功能的工具。随着互联网的快速发展,语音视频SDK在各个领域得到了广泛应用,如在线教育、远程医疗、视频会议等。然而,很多开发者对语音视频SDK的设备性能要求并不了解,以下将从多个方面详细阐述语音视频SDK对设备性能的要求。
一、处理器性能
处理器是设备的“大脑”,其性能直接影响到语音视频SDK的运行效果。以下是处理器性能对语音视频SDK的影响:
处理器主频:处理器主频越高,处理能力越强,可以更好地支持高分辨率视频的实时编码和解码。一般来说,处理器主频应不低于2.0GHz。
处理器核心数:多核心处理器可以同时处理多个任务,提高语音视频SDK的运行效率。建议选择至少4核心的处理器。
处理器架构:64位处理器在内存管理、多任务处理等方面具有优势,可以更好地支持语音视频SDK的运行。
二、内存容量
内存是语音视频SDK运行的基础,以下为内存容量对语音视频SDK的影响:
运行内存:运行内存越大,语音视频SDK可以同时处理更多的数据,提高运行效率。建议运行内存不低于4GB。
系统内存:系统内存决定了操作系统和应用程序的运行空间。建议系统内存不低于8GB。
三、存储容量
存储容量对语音视频SDK的影响主要体现在以下两个方面:
应用程序安装:语音视频SDK的应用程序较大,需要一定的存储空间。建议存储容量不低于16GB。
视频文件存储:语音视频SDK在传输过程中会产生大量的视频文件,需要足够的存储空间。建议存储容量不低于64GB。
四、网络性能
网络性能是语音视频SDK运行的关键因素,以下为网络性能对语音视频SDK的影响:
带宽:带宽越高,语音视频传输速度越快,延迟越低。建议带宽不低于10Mbps。
网络稳定性:网络稳定性直接影响到语音视频通信的质量。建议使用稳定的宽带网络。
网络延迟:网络延迟越低,语音视频通信越流畅。建议网络延迟低于100ms。
五、摄像头和麦克风性能
摄像头和麦克风是语音视频SDK实现实时视频和音频通信的关键设备,以下为摄像头和麦克风性能对语音视频SDK的影响:
摄像头分辨率:摄像头分辨率越高,视频画面越清晰。建议摄像头分辨率不低于720p。
摄像头帧率:摄像头帧率越高,视频画面越流畅。建议摄像头帧率不低于30fps。
麦克风灵敏度:麦克风灵敏度越高,语音采集越清晰。建议麦克风灵敏度不低于-40dB。
六、操作系统
操作系统是语音视频SDK运行的平台,以下为操作系统对语音视频SDK的影响:
操作系统稳定性:操作系统稳定性越高,语音视频SDK运行越稳定。建议使用主流的操作系统,如Windows、macOS、Android、iOS等。
操作系统版本:操作系统版本越高,对语音视频SDK的支持越好。建议使用最新版本的操作系统。
总结
语音视频SDK对设备性能有较高的要求,包括处理器性能、内存容量、存储容量、网络性能、摄像头和麦克风性能以及操作系统等方面。只有满足这些要求,才能保证语音视频SDK的运行效果。因此,在选择设备时,开发者应充分考虑以上因素,以确保语音视频SDK的稳定运行。
猜你喜欢:IM即时通讯